I just swapped out my old blown h23a1 for a jdm h22a. It is SURELY a whole different car now. More power (+40) and now VTEC!!

By just reading up in forums here and there i have learned that an h23 is better to boost being that the block is beefier, but an h22 stock has more power and VTEC than the h23 stock. Correct me if i'm wrong but the h23a1 has 160hp and the h22a1 is at 190hp. the JDM h22a puts out 200hp. i dont have any clue what the JDM h23 puts out. I know there is a blue top VTEC h23 from the JDM Accord Wagons as well but was told that it is still only 160hp, just VTEC.
